Output bc63b98b8a60e91d3301cfcda86ca9ffbbfdf8dc7fb543136b48a0e614f18953:16

value
66218713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b48ab5ea81cf40f9bc95e91163b62dadb6ec11b OP_EQUAL
address
376Ur2BCDsLwyL46V3zEiso3UAqW4G21NF
transaction
bc63b98b8a60e91d3301cfcda86ca9ffbbfdf8dc7fb543136b48a0e614f18953
confirmations
462056
spent
true